Hi. New lurker coming out of the woodwork here..
I've owned a 1976 911S Targa for about 7 years now and it's time to try and fix the targa top. No real damage other than some vinyl wear, but it's not sealing right at the middle on both front and back (gapping). It looks like the center section of the top is pushed forward from where it should be compared to the sides. I'm thinking that I should be able to pull the liner off and do some re-alignment on the folding frame to get it to fit correctly again. Anyone have pointers to a good website, book or any other reference on how to work on a targa top they could send my way?? TIA! Lee |

Do a search on this forum because it has been discussed multiple times. Unfortunately the Targa tops aren't "maintenance free" so to speak, they do need to be adjusted from time to time. Occasionally, after long use they will also need to be recovered and the seals redone. But given the fact that you are getting a gap, I would almost hazard a guess that you just need to readjust the top (which is some allen keys etc).
Anyway, have a look over some past posts and good luck! |
